What is super visa insurance?
One of the requirements of being approved for a Super Visa is that you have medical insurance that covers you for at least one year from the date of entry to Canada.
The medical insurance can be from any Canadian insurance company or a prescribed non-Canadian insurer (more on this later).
Basically Canada wants to make sure that you’re not going to be a financial burden on the publicly funded heath system when you visit. So you need to prove that you’ve got insurance that will cover you for any medical needs you have when you’re in Canada. You can read more about Canada’s healthcare system here.
If you are planning on visiting Canada for less than 6 months at a time then you don’t need a Super Visa or Super Visa insurance. All you would need is a standard visitor visa or Electronic Travel Authorization (eTA) and standard visitor to Canada health insurance.

Super visa insurance requirements
To be approved for a Canada Super Visa, you must have medical insurance that:
- Covers you for at least one year from the date you enter Canada.
- Is purchased from a Canadian insurance company or an authorised non-Canadian company (see more details in the section below).
- Provides coverage of at least $100,000.
- Includes healthcare, hospitalization, and repatriation.
- Has been fully purchased (quotes are not accepted, but installment payments are allowed).

Who can you buy Super Visa insurance from?
As of January 28, 2025,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C) has expanded the list of approved insurance providers for the Super Visa program.
Previously, applicants were required to purchase health insurance exclusively from Canadian insurance companies. With the policy change, you can now obtain Super Visa insurance from both Canadian and certain international insurers, provided they meet specific criteria.
Approved Super Visa insurance providers:
- Canadian insurance companies: All Canadian insurers authorized to sell health insurance are eligible to provide Super Visa insurance policies.
- International insurance companies: Non-Canadian insurers must
- be authorized by the Office of the Superintendent of Financial Institutions (OSFI) under the Insurance Companies Act to offer accident and sickness insurance in Canada.
- be on the OSFI list of federally regulated financial institutions
- have issued the policy as part of their insurance business in Canada
It’s crucial that if you do get your insurance from a non-Canadian insurer that it complies with the Canadian requirements.
The policy documents from foreign insurers must show the name of the company issuing the insurance and state that the policy was issued or made in the course of its insurance business in Canada.

The cost of Super Visa medical insurance varies based on:
- Age
- Pre-existing health conditions
- Deductible amount (higher deductible = lower premium)
- Length of coverage
- Insurance provider
Here’s an estimate for a one-year policy with $100,000 coverage:
- Ages 40-54: $800 – $1,300
- Ages 55-64: $1,300 – $1,500
- Ages 65-74: $1,500 – $3,000
- Ages 75+: $3,000+
Note: These are rough estimates. Actual prices will depend on your specific situation.
Those ranges go up markedly if you have pre-existing medical conditions, with the cheapest for someone in their early 70s with a stable pre-existing medical condition starting at around $2,300.

Super visa insurance monthly
Clearly the premium for any super visa health insurance is not insubstantial. So you might be looking at the best way to finance the Canadian medical insurance for super visa.
Some insurers allow monthly payments, but this almost always comes at a higher overall cost. In fact, monthly payment plans can be up to 30% more expensive than paying in full.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Can I cancel my Super Visa insurance policy if my visa is denied?
Yes, most insurance providers will refund your premium if your Super Visa application is denied, but check the policy terms before purchasing.
Is there an age limit for Super Visa insurance?
While there is no official age limit for the Super Visa, some insurance companies may have restrictions on applicants over a certain age. It’s best to compare multiple providers to find coverage that fits your needs.
Does Super Visa insurance cover COVID-19?
Most Super Visa insurance policies now include COVID-19 coverage, but always check the fine print to confirm what’s covered.
How long does it take to get a Super Visa insurance policy?
You can typically get a policy within 24-48 hours after purchasing, though processing times may vary depending on the insurer.
